Output ecc054ce948589b03ae836412e895cf53c50e95b96e14837988058a1dbef4083:0

value
1456931
script pubkey
OP_0 OP_PUSHBYTES_20 bf4c705e86872a115a306ccaca92bfdfbdb7b323
address
bc1qhax8qh5xsu4pzk3sdn9v4y4lm77m0verclnq0e
transaction
ecc054ce948589b03ae836412e895cf53c50e95b96e14837988058a1dbef4083
confirmations
89760
spent
true